How Gwinnett County Public Defenders: The Difference They Make in Local Communities Actually Works
Public defenders are licensed attorneys assigned to represent individuals who cannot afford private counsel. In Gwinnett County, these professionals handle a wide variety of cases. They may support people charged with misdemeanors or more serious offenses. Each case receives careful review and preparation by the defense team. The goal is to ensure that legal rights are upheld throughout every stage.
The process often begins shortly after an arrest or citation. A court determines whether someone qualifies for appointed representation. If eligible, a public defender is assigned to the matter. This attorney then investigates facts, reviews evidence, and interviews witnesses. They negotiate with prosecutors to explore possible resolutions. Throughout this process, they advocate for fair treatment under the law.
These professionals also manage high caseloads with structured support systems. They work alongside investigators, paralegals, and administrative staff. This team approach helps maintain consistent standards across cases. Clients are kept informed about options, timelines, and potential outcomes. By balancing compassion with professionalism, they serve as a stabilizing force. Things People Often Misunderstand
A common myth is that public defenders are less qualified than private attorneys. In reality, these lawyers must meet the same licensing and experience requirements. Many have advanced training in negotiation, trial work, and appellate practice. They stay current with changes in laws and courtroom procedures. Respect for the profession should be based on skill and dedication.
Some believe that accepting a public defender means losing control of the case. Clients might fear that their attorney will not communicate or make decisions without input. Effective defense teams prioritize client involvement and explain each step clearly. They seek consent before major choices and keep people updated regularly. Trust grows when expectations are managed honestly.
Another misunderstanding is that public defense only matters for serious criminal charges. Even minor offenses can affect jobs, housing, and records. Legal guidance helps people understand potential consequences and alternatives. Early support can prevent small issues from becoming larger problems. This broader view shows how public defense serves everyday residents.
